Default Tint Exemption in MI

I've been looking into getting my windows tinted. I know the law of MI states front windows can only have the first 4 inches done, unless you have a medical exemption. So, I went to my eye doctor today (he wasnt in) and asked about it. I told the recptionst that I have light sensitive eyes, and that even on cloudy days my eyes are bothered. It has gotten to the point that even sunglasses are not enough.

They just kinda laughed at me and told me that all i have to do is talk to him tomorrow, but he is more that likely going to say no (unless im an 80yr old lady that has trouble seeing.)

So, im just wondering if any of you have encountered this, and what the outcome was. Basically im going to get it done no matter what, because if i can prevent my eyes from being bothered, then im going to.

I had tint on my Lexus 20% around... got a few tickets some thrown away.

I ended up going to the doctor w/ my dad and we both got notes that we can show the officer.

It didn't help - they still give you tickets and you still have to go to court and that crap. Although they didn't believe me in court, they didnt' make me pay the time I had the note.
